Excelでスペルチェックを行う方法

単一のセル、複数のセル、ワークシート全体、複数のワークシート、またはExcelのブック全体でスペルミスをチェックできます。

ほとんどの人はMicrosoftWordとPowerpointのスペルチェックとオートコレクト機能について知っていますが、MSExcelもスペルチェック機能を容易にすることを知っていますか。 Wordほど強力で高度ではありませんが、基本的なスペルチェック機能を備えています。ワークシートのセル内の単語のスペルをチェックし、シートに間違いがないことを確認できます。

Microsoft WordやPowerPointとは異なり、Excelは、入力時に文法の問題を自動的にチェックしたり、スペルをチェックしたりしません(赤で下線を引くことにより)。 MS Excelは、スペルチェック機能を手動で実行した場合にのみスペルエラーを通知します。また、Excelは文法エラーをチェックしません。

数値や数式を扱うことが多いため、ほとんどの場合、Excelのスペルミスは無視します。ただし、列や行のラベルなどのテキストやワークシート全体を含むレポートやデータセットを作成するときに、スペルミスがないかどうかを確認する必要がある場合があります。単一のセル、複数のセル、ワークシート全体、一度に複数のワークシート、またはワークブック全体でスペルチェックを実行する方法を学びましょう。

スペルチェックの実行方法 Excelで

次の手順に従って、MicrosoftExcel内でスペルチェックを簡単に実行できます。

Excelでスペルチェック機能を実行するには、2つの方法があります。Excelリボンからツールにアクセスするか、キーボードショートカットを使用してツールにアクセスできます。

まず、いくつかのスペルミスのあるスプレッドシートを開き、任意のセルを選択します。 [レビュー]タブに移動し、Excelリボンの[校正]グループの左側にある[スペル]ボタンをクリックします。

または、キーボードショートカットのF7ファンクションキーを押して、[スペルチェック]ダイアログボックスを開くこともできます。スプレッドシートで単一のセルを選択すると、Excelは現在のスプレッドシート全体のスペルミスを自動的にチェックします。

いずれにせよ、[スペルチェック]ダイアログボックスが開きます。 Excelはワークシートのスペルミスのチェックを開始し、正しいスペルの提案を提供します。

[スペル]ダイアログで、[提案:]ボックスから提案を選択し、[変更]ボタンをクリックして、単語のスペルミスを修正します。そのスペルが修正された後、次のエラーに進みます。このボックスは、単語のつづりが間違っているセルにのみ表示されます。ここでは、提案リストから最初の単語「Probability」を選択して、スペルミスのある単語「Propability」を置き換え、「Change」ボタンをクリックします。

すべてのスペルが修正されると、Excelは「スペルチェックが完了しました」と表示します。あなたは行ってもいいです」というメッセージ。プロンプトボックスで[OK]をクリックして続行します。

シートにエラーが見つかった場合にのみ、Excelは[スペルチェック]ダイアログボックスを表示します。エラーが見つからなかった場合、Excelは上記と同じメッセージを表示します。

スペルチェック機能が機能しない場合(つまり、[レビュー]タブの下の[スペルチェック]ボタンがグレー表示されている場合)、スプレッドシートが保護されている可能性があります。スペルミスをチェックする前に、ワークシートの「保護を解除」してください。

[スペルチェック]ダイアログボックスのさまざまなオプション

セル、ワークシート全体、複数のワークシート、またはワークブック全体のスペルチェックを実行する方法を学習する前に、[スペル]ダイアログボックスのさまざまなオプションとそれらをカスタマイズする方法を理解する必要があります。単語を修正するときは、適切なオプションを選択する必要があります。

次に、[スペルチェック]ダイアログボックスに表示される機能の一部を示します。

  • 一度無視する– スペルチェックでエラーとして識別された単語が検出され、その単語が実際に目的に合っている場合は、[一度無視]ボタンをクリックして、現在のスペルチェックエラーの提案を無視します。例えば。名前、住所など
  • すべて無視 –現在のスペルミスのある単語のすべてのインスタンスを無視し、元の値を保持する場合は、このオプションをクリックします。たとえば、同じ名前を複数回繰り返す場合、このオプションをクリックすると、それらの単語を変更せずにすべてスキップし、時間を節約できます。
  • 辞書に追加– Excelが現在の単語をエラーと見なしているが、それが正しい単語であり、頻繁に使用する単語である場合、その単語が正しく使用されている限り、このスペルミスの単語をMicrosoftExcel辞書に追加できます。これにより、単語がMS辞書の一部になり、今後、ブックや他のMicrosoft製品でエラーとしてフラグが立てられることはありません。
  • 変化する –スペルチェックエラーが検出されると、Excelは提案のリストを表示します。提案された単語の1つを選択し、このボタンをクリックして、現在選択されているスペルミスのある単語を正しい単語に置き換えます。
  • すべて変更 –このオプションは、現在の単語だけでなく、スペルミスのある単語のすべての出現箇所を選択された提案に置き換えます。
  • オートコレクト –このオプションをクリックすると、Excelは、選択した提案でスペルミスのある単語を自動的に修正します。また、オートコレクトリストに単語が追加されます。つまり、将来同じスペルミスの単語を入力すると、Excelはこれを選択した候補に自動的に変換します。
  • 辞書言語 –このドロップダウンを使用して、Excel辞書の言語を変更できます。
  • オプション –このボタンをクリックすると、[Excelオプション]に移動し、デフォルトのスペルチェック設定を適宜確認または変更できます。
  • 最後に元に戻す –このボタンをクリックして、最後のアクションを元に戻します。

Excelのスペルチェックの設定をカスタマイズする

Excelでスペルチェックのデフォルト設定を変更する場合は、[スペル]ダイアログボックスの[オプション]をクリックするか、[ファイル]タブに移動して[オプション]をクリックします。

Excelオプションの[校正]タブには、必要に応じてカスタマイズできるスペルチェックのデフォルト設定があります。

Excelは、大文字(HEETHEN)の単語、数字(Rage123)を含むテキスト、IP /ファイルアドレス、またはインターネットコードを無視し、間違いとは見なされません。また、繰り返される単語にエラーのフラグを立てます。たとえば、「Say hello to to my little friend」と入力すると、フラグが付けられ、追加の「to」がエラーとして表示されます。必要に応じて、これらのオプションを有効または無効にできます。

Excel辞書を追加または編集する場合は、[カスタム辞書]オプションをクリックします。

次に、カスタム辞書の単語リストを編集するには、[辞書リスト]の下の[CUSTOM.DIC]を選択し、[単語リストの編集...]ボタンをクリックします。

辞書に追加する単語を[単語:]フィールドに入力し、[追加]をクリックします。すでに追加されている単語をリストから削除する場合は、単語を選択し、[削除]または[すべて削除]をクリックしてすべての単語を削除します。次に、[OK]を2回クリックして、両方のダイアログを閉じます。

また、カスタム辞書に追加された単語は、他のMicrosoft製品でエラーとしてフラグが立てられることはありません。 Excelでカスタム辞書に単語を追加した場合、WordまたはPowerpointではエラーとは見なされず、その逆も同様です。

オートコレクト設定を変更する場合は、Excelオプションの[オートコレクトオプション]をクリックします。

ここで、オートコレクトの設定をカスタマイズできます。

入力するときに、ワークシートで単語のスペルを数回間違えることがよくあります。これらの単語をオートコレクトリストに追加することで、これらの間違いを修正できます。このように、Excelはあなたが書いている間にこれらの単語を自動修正します。

これを行うには、[置換]セクションにスペルミスのある単語を入力し、下のリストから正しい単語を選択するか、[あり]セクションに入力します。次に、[OK]をクリックして適用します。

Excelで単一のセル/テキストのスペルチェック

Excelでは、単一のセル値(Word)のスペルミスをチェックできます。

Excelドキュメント内の単一のセルのスペルを確認するには、セルを選択してダブルクリックするか、F2キーを押して編集モードに入ります。セルで編集モードになっていることを確認してください。編集モードの場合は、セルにテキストカーソルが表示され、Excelウィンドウの左下隅にあるステータスバーに[編集]が表示されます(以下を参照)。

次に、[レビュー]タブの[スペル]ボタンをクリックするか、F7キーを押します。

Excelがスペルミスを検出すると、提案ボックスが表示されます。それ以外の場合は、「スペルチェックが完了しました」というメッセージが表示されます。

正しい単語を選択し、[変更]をクリックしてスペルを修正します。次に、[スペルチェックの完了]ダイアログボックスで[OK]をクリックします。

単一のワークシートで複数のセル/単語のスペルチェック

複数のセルを一緒にスペルチェックする場合は、それらのセルのみを選択し、[スペルチェック]ダイアログボックスを使用して行うことができます。この方法は、名前と住所の列にエラーのチェックをスキップする場合に便利です。名前と住所には通常、スペルミスのフラグが付けられているためです。

まず、スペルをチェックするセル、範囲、列、または行を選択します。隣接するセルを選択する場合は、マウスドラッグまたはShift +矢印キーを使用して選択します。

隣接していないセル(隣接していないセル)を選択する場合は、Ctrlキーを押したまま、選択するセルをクリックします。選択するセルの数が多い場合は、Shift + F8を押して放し、選択したい数のセルをクリックします。次に、Shift + F8をもう一度押して、選択モードをオフにします。

セルを選択したら、[レビュー]タブに切り替えて、リボンの[スペル]を選択するか、F7キーを押します。

選択したセルまたは範囲の最初のスペルミスのある単語(Excelで見つかった場合)を置き換えるためのいくつかの提案を含む[スペルチェック]ダイアログボックスが表示されます。

次に、正しい候補を選択するか、[変更]オプションをクリックするか、[オートコレクト]を使用して正しいスペルを自動的に選択し、次のスペルミスのある単語に移動します。

または、[一度無視]をクリックして提案を却下し、次のスペルミスのある単語に進むこともできます。

最初のスペルミスの単語が修正されると、同じダイアログボックスに次のスペルミスの単語の提案が表示されます。エラーを修正するための適切なオプションを選択してください。同様に、スペルミスのあるすべての単語を1つずつ修正できます。

スペルミスのある単語がすべて修正されると、「成功」のプロンプトが表示されます。

ワークシート全体のスペルチェック

Excelでワークシート全体をスペルチェックするには、チェックするワークシートのセルを選択するか、スペルチェックを実行するワークシートのタブをクリックして、[スペルチェック]オプションをクリックします(またはF7キーを押します)。 )[レビュー]タブの下。

Excelはエラーのチェックを開始し、エラーを修正するための提案を行います。

スペルチェックを実行すると、現在選択されているセルからワークシートの最後までスペルチェックが行われます。セルA1を選択すると、Excelは最初の行(左から右)のすべてのセルのチェックを開始し、次に2番目の行に移動して、2番目の行(左から右)のすべてのセルをチェックしてから、 3行目など。

たとえば、A4を選択すると、行4のすべてのセルを(水平方向に)通過し、次にその下の行を通過します。 A4以降のすべてのセルをチェックした後、Excelは「シートの最初からチェックを続行しますか?」というプロンプトボックスを表示します。以下に示すように、最初からスペルチェックを続行するには、[はい]をクリックします。

一度に複数のシートをスペルチェック

Excelでは、複数のワークシートのスペルをまとめて確認できます。方法は次のとおりです。

複数のワークシートのスペルをチェックするには、Ctrlキーを押したまま、チェックする複数のシートタブを選択します。 [レビュー]タブの下にある[スペル]ボタンをクリックするか、F7キーを押して、スペルチェックを開始します。

これにより、スペルチェックプロセスが開始され、すべてのエラーがダイアログボックスに1つずつポップアップ表示されます。

適切なオプションを選択してすべてのエラーを修正すると、確認メッセージで通知するダイアログボックスが表示されます。

ワークブック内のすべてのワークシートを一度にスペルチェックする

ワークブックに多数のワークシートがある場合は、それらすべてを一度に簡単にスペルチェックできます。

ワークブック内のすべてのワークシートのスペルチェックを行うには、ワークシートのタブを右クリックして、コンテキストメニューから[すべてのシートを選択]を選択します。

これにより、ワークブック内のすべてのワークシートが選択されます。次に、F7キーを押すか、[レビュー]リボンタブの下にある[スペルチェック]ボタンをクリックします。すべてのワークシートを選択すると、以下に示すように、すべてのタブが白い背景で表示されます。

これで、Excelはブック内のすべてのワークシートのスペルチェックを行います。

数式内のスペルチェックワード

数式の一部であるテキストをチェックしようとすると、それは機能せず、スペルチェックはワークシートの最初に戻ります。編集モードでは、数式のシェル内にあるテキストのみを確認できます。

数式内の単語のスペルを確認する場合は、数式のあるセルをダブルクリックするか、数式バーの数式内の単語を選択します。次に、F7キーを押すか、[レビュー]リボンタブの下にある[スペルチェック]ボタンをクリックして、スペルチェックを実行します。

ExcelVBAマクロを使用してスペルミスを強調表示する

Excelマクロを使用して、現在のワークシートでスペルミスのある単語を見つけて強調表示することもできます。このためには、VBAエディターでマクロを作成する必要があります。これを行う方法は次のとおりです。

まず、スペルミスのある単語を強調表示するワークシートを開きます。次に、[開発者]タブの下にある[Visual Basic]ボタンをクリックするか、ショートカットキーAlt + F11を押してExcelVBAエディターを開きます。

Microsoft VBAエディターで、[挿入]メニューをクリックし、[モジュール]オプションを選択します。

次に、次のコードをコピーしてモジュールエディタに貼り付けます。

Sub ColorMispelledCells()For Each cl In ActiveSheet.UsedRange If Not Application.CheckSpelling(Word:= cl.Text)Then _ cl.Interior.ColorIndex = 8 Next cl End Sub

コードを貼り付けたら、ツールバーの[実行]ボタンをクリックするか、[F5]キーを押してマクロを実行します。

マクロを実行したら、ワークシートを確認します。また、スペルが間違っている単語を含むすべてのセルは、以下に示すように強調表示されます。

Excelでのスペルチェックについて知っておく必要があるのはこれだけです。